Faba Bean in the Nile Valley. Report on the First Phase of the ICARDA/IFAD Nile Valley Project. 1983. Saxena, M.C.; Stewart, R.A. (eds.). Martinus Nijhoff Publishers for ICARDA. 149 pp.

This book covers the activities of a collaborative research project between ICARDA and IFAD (International Fund for Agricultural Development) to improve faba bean production in Egypt and Sudan by strengthening research on this important crop. It also summarizes the main research findings of the first three years of the project up to 1982 when the first phase was completed.

Ascochyta Blight and Winter Sowing of Chickpea.
1984. Saxena, M.C.; Singh, K.B. (eds.). Martinus Nijhoff/Dr. W. Junk Publishers and ICARDA. 288 pp.

This book is based on a workshop, held from 4 to 7 May 1981, on Ascochyta Blight and Winter Sowing of Chickpeas in the West Asia and North Africa region. The papers evaluate the major breakthrough in research on food legumes in the region, including the advancement of the sowing date for chickpeas from spring to winter.

Increasing Small Ruminant Productivity in Semi-arid Areas. 1988. Proceedings of a Workshop, 30 Nov - 3 Dec 1987, Aleppo, Syria. Thomson, E.F. ; Thomson, F.S. (eds.). Kluwer Academic Publishers and ICARDA. 296 pp.

This book contains the text of papers which were presented to give a background to the workshop and disciplinary groups, which focused on the interactions between disciplines, and formulated recommenda-tions for future research. The papers deal with livestock systems and nutrition, animal breeding and animal health aspects relevant to North Africa and West Asia.

Breeding for Stress Tolerance in Cool-season Food Legumes.
1993. Singh, K.B.; Saxena, M.C. (eds.). John Wiley & Sons, Sayce Publishing and ICARDA. 474 pp.

This book discusses the challenge of developing resistance to abiotic and biotic stress in cool-season food legumes, presents the problems and prospects of stress resistance breeding, and screening for resistance to viral, fungal and bacterial diseases, insect pests, nematodes and broomrapes, as well as to climatic stresses and soil problems. Other topics discussed include the use of molecular genetics, the application of mutagenesis, the use of wild species and the use of germplasm resources, different aspects of breeding for stress resistance, including durable resistance, multiple-stress resistance, and breeding for self- and cross-pollinated crops.

Lentil and Faba Bean in Latin America. Their Importance, Limiting Factors and Research. Special Study Report. 1993. Bascur B., G. 156 pp. English and Spanish versions.

This book reviews the current situation of lentil and faba bean in South America with regard to production zones, area under cultivation, production, yield, uses, markets, and production constraints; an analysis of the research in different countries, importance, objectives, national programs, needs and results, and a proposal in the form of recommendations for future action for improving research on lentils and faba beans; and a review of the literature published on both crops.

Plant Nutrient Management under Pressurized Irrigation Systems in the Mediterranean Region. Proceedings of the IMPHOS International Fertigation Workshop, 25-27 Apr 1999. 2000. Ryan, J. (ed.) Amman, Jordan. WPI (IMPHOS)/ICAR-DA/JPMC/NCARTT. 400 pp.

This book contains the papers presented at the workshop. The papers emphasize the importance of proper plant nutrient management to promote and sustain productive and efficient cropping systems under pressurized irrigation, review the current fertigation and the range of phosphorus sources available for fertigation in the Mediterranean region, address various economic and environmental issues related to fertigation, and discuss research and development needs in relation to phosphorus fertigation in the Mediterranean region. The resulting proceedings represent an effective collaboration between the fertil-izer industry and both national agricultural research systems, and international research centers to improve agriculture and the welfare of mankind.
